Одновременно подвинуть объекты из нескольких слоев

Вопросы по свободной ГИС QGIS. Сообщения об ошибках, предложения по улучшению, локализация.
Ответить
Аватара пользователя
chet2
Активный участник
Сообщения: 104
Зарегистрирован: 08 дек 2016, 09:46
Репутация: 6

Одновременно подвинуть объекты из нескольких слоев

Сообщение chet2 » 28 сен 2017, 15:55

Есть набор слоев разного типа (точки, линии, полигоны).
Нужно одновременно подвинуть объекты из этих слоев.

Пробовал сделать все слои редактируемыми, выделить все объекты с помощью модуля Multiple Layer Selection и подвинуть. Не выходит...

Подскажите пожалуйста возможные варианты.

Александр Мурый
Гуру
Сообщения: 5173
Зарегистрирован: 26 сен 2009, 16:26
Репутация: 793
Ваше звание: званий не имею
Откуда: Москва

Re: Одновременно подвинуть объекты из нескольких слоев

Сообщение Александр Мурый » 28 сен 2017, 16:18

Не очень интерактивный, зато рабочий метод: действовать через афинные преобразования (сдвиг, масштабирование, вращение). Например, есть плагин "Affine Transformations".

Но лучше через Processing ("Анализ данных"), модуль GRASS <v.transform>. Там жмём "Run as batch process", заполняем нужные поля (если не надо менять что-то, ставим нули); имена выходных файлов можно сгенерить автоматом; PROFIT.
Редактор материалов, модератор форума

Аватара пользователя
chet2
Активный участник
Сообщения: 104
Зарегистрирован: 08 дек 2016, 09:46
Репутация: 6

Re: Одновременно подвинуть объекты из нескольких слоев

Сообщение chet2 » 29 сен 2017, 08:47

Александр Мурый, спасибо большое! Воспользовался GRASS.

Ответить

Вернуться в «QGIS»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 18 гостей